we keep an eye on the specials board-and my wife always goes for the 'blue carbon' salt marsh beef-it is probably the best steak she has eaten. Beautifully cooked and she asks for plenty of fat - often restaurants seem to pre trim their steaks -not here- it arrives with an excellent amount still attached. I go for the mussels when they have them -they are beautiful -if they are not available -scampi and chips are always great. The prices are very reasonable indeed. The hot desserts finish the meal with the same quality.
